2. WHAT ARE COOKIES?
Cookies are small text files that are placed on your device by websites you visit. They are widely used to make Websites work more efficiently, as well as provide information to the site owners.
Cookies help us recognise your browser or device and remember certain information about your visits, such as your preferences or login status. They allow us to analyse traffic and usage patterns to improve the user experience.
Cookies can be stored for different lengths of time:
- Session cookies are temporary and are deleted once you close your browser.
- Persistent cookies remain on your device for a set period or until you delete them, allowing us to recognise you on return visits.

3. TYPES OF COOKIES
Different types of cookies can be used across online services to provide functionality, enhance user experience, and help understand how a platform is used. The main categories of cookies include:
- Necessary Cookies - these are essential for the Online Services to function properly. They enable core features such as secure log-in, page navigation, and consent management. These cookies do not collect personally identifiable information.
- Functional Cookies - allow the Online Services to remember choices you make (such as display preferences) and enable enhanced features like social sharing or feedback collection. These cookies may be set by us or by third-party providers.
- Analytics Cookies - collect information about how visitors use our Online Services, such as which pages are visited most often or if users encounter errors. The data is aggregated and anonymised and helps us improve Platform performance and user experience.
- Performance Cookies - measure how the Online Services is performing, often in terms of speed, responsiveness, and load balancing. They help us ensure the site runs smoothly for all users.
- Advertising Cookies - used to deliver relevant advertisements to you based on your browsing behaviour and interests. They also help us measure the effectiveness of advertising campaigns. These may be set by us or by third-party ad partners.
